Ticket #6630 — Cleaning-crew access, Pellham House

Night shift: cleaning crew from Silverbroom arrives 23:30, Mon–Thu. Four people, ground floor and level 2 only. Check names against the roster sheet at the desk. They bring their own cart; the cupboard by the loading dock stays theirs. No access to the server room corridor — that's off their route as of this week. Log arrival and departure times.

Let them through the rear entrance with the code below.

door code, tagef-bajop: bdg-SB-7

- [ ] Step 7: Archive cold storage buckets (Glacierline tier). Confirm both ceremony witnesses are present, verify bucket manifests match the Oxbow ledger, then seal the archive key shares. Plugin authors may observe but not handle shares. Once sealed, the archive index itself is encrypted and can only be reopened with the passphrase below.

vault phrase of badup-hahig = tamael-aldael-kelmir-istael-fenok-istwyn-tamius-jorath-oliion

## StageGrid Environments

StageGrid is the seat-map renderer behind the Velloway Theatre booking flow. We run three environments: dev (fake seat data, refreshes nightly), staging (mirrors the Velloway main-hall layout), and prod. Rendering quirks usually show up in staging first, so test your layout changes there before tagging a reviewer. Each environment reads its own config bundle at boot. The staging values are listed below.

config for badup-kagap:
OLIOX_PIN=5344
OLIOX_METRICS_HOST=metrics.oliox.zemvarcorp.corp
OLIOX_LOG_LEVEL=error
OLIOX_TENANT=pelox

## Ownership

The TidePane widget ships as part of the Harborline SDK but is maintained separately from core. Plugin authors must not fork the tide-table rendering logic; extend via the documented hooks only. Breaking changes are announced one release ahead. Bug reports go through the standard tracker; feature requests require a short proposal. All questions about the widget's roadmap go to the person named below.

named custodian: Oliath Ralax